é''á 1. Excessive Use Of Lethal Force When Protecting One's Property, Defense of Family Or Self-Defense
a. If an animal rustler âÌÇðÌÈá of a break-in
is discovered at night, and the âÌÇðÌÈá is fatally assaulted in the owner's exercise of protecting family or property, then there is no liability for the death of the âÌÇðÌÈá.
Home intruder b. But if there is daylight sufficient to discern that lethal force wasn't warranted in the owner's proper exercise of self-defense in carrying out the proper protection of family or property, then the property owner shall be guilty of manslaughter.
c. Otherwise, the âÌÇðÌÈá shall pay restitution for any damages.
é''á 2. Rustled Livestock Recovered Alive
If domestic livestock be found alive in the possession of the rustler âÌÇðÌÈá, whether working livestock or kâ•sheirꞋ livestock, the âÌÇðÌÈá shall pay double value in damages.
If the âÌÇðÌÈá lacks the money to pay the court-assessed damages, then the court shall indenture the âÌÇðÌÈá until the debt has been worked-off or the indenture otherwise redeemed.
